Transcription of AUGUST 2017 COVERAGE, CODING & PAYMENT BULLETIN - …

1 AUGUST 2017 . coverage , CODING &. PAYMENT BULLETIN Micra . Transcatheter Pacing system CMS Approval of the Medtronic Micra Transcatheter Pacing system Post-Approval Study (PAS) & Prospective Longitudinal Study, the Micra CED. Brief Background Micra Transcatheter Pacing system is the world's smallest pacemaker, delivered percutaneously via a minimally invasive approach, directly into the right ventricle without the use of leads. Leadless pacemakers, also known as intracardiac or transcatheter pacemakers, are the first and only pacemakers in which the components are combined into a single device implanted directly within the heart, without any subcutaneous pocket or tunneling. This is in contrast to traditional transvenous pacemakers that require a subcutaneous generator plus transvenous/epicardial lead(s).

2 On July 28, 2017 , the Centers for Medicare & Medicaid Services (CMS) released the National coverage Determination for the Leadless Effective Jan. 18, 2017 , the CMS will cover leadless pacemakers that are used according to the FDA-labeled indications for the device through coverage with Evidence Development (CED) as outlined below. Nationally Covered Indications CMS will provide coverage for leadless pacemakers when procedures are performed: In an FDA-approved post approval study (PAS) such as the Micra Transcatheter Pacing system Post-Approval Study (PAS);. or In a prospective longitudinal study for leadless pacemakers that have either: An associated ongoing FDA-approved PAS; or Completed an FDA PAS. Each study must be approved by CMS and listed on the CMS website before coverage is effective and PAYMENT can be made.

3 CMS has reviewed and approved the Micra PAS (effective Feb. 9, 2017 ) and the Longitudinal coverage with Evidence Development Study on Micra Leadless Pacemakers, hereafter referred to as the Micra CED prospective longitudinal study, known as the Micra CED (effective March 9, 2017 ). Additional details on each study are below. FDA Post-Approval Study: The Medtronic Micra PAS was approved by the FDA in April 2016. The National Clinical Trial (NCT) number assigned to this study is NCT02536118. Effective Feb. 9, 2017 and as posted on CMS' CED website at: coverage -with-Evidence- , the Micra PAS has been approved by CMS as meeting the CED. requirement for leadless pacemaker coverage . This means Medicare patients enrolled and implanted at a trained and contracted Micra PAS site are eligible for coverage and PAYMENT .

4 Prospective Longitudinal Study: The Micra CED study allows broad patient access for leadless pacemaker implants meeting FDA indications. The NCT. number assigned to this study is NCT03039712. CMS approved this study on March 9, 2017 and their posting on the CMS CED website is at: Micra procedures performed according to FDA indications are eligible for Medicare coverage and reimbursement. Page 1 of 6 | AUGUST 2017 . FDA Approved Indications Leadless pacemakers are non-covered when furnished outside of a CMS approved study. As a reminder, the Micra leadless pacemaker device is FDA approved for patients who have experienced one or more of the following conditions: Symptomatic paroxysmal or permanent high-grade AV block in the presence of AF. Symptomatic paroxysmal or permanent high-grade AV block in the absence of AF, as an alternative to dual chamber pacing, when atrial lead placement is considered difficult, high risk, or not deemed necessary for effective therapy Symptomatic bradycardia-tachycardia syndrome or sinus node dysfunction (sinus bradycardia or sinus pauses), as an alternative to atrial or dual chamber pacing, when atrial lead placement is considered difficult, high risk, or not deemed necessary for effective therapy CODING for Leadless Pacemaker Therapy These CODING suggestions do not replace seeking CODING advice from the payer and/or your own CODING staff.

5 The ultimate responsibility for correct CODING lies with the provider of services. The medical record must include documentation to support the medical necessity of the procedure and the diagnosis and procedure codes selected to report the service. Physician and Hospital Outpatient Procedure Codes The following Category III CPT 2 codes describe procedures associated with leadless (transcatheter) pacemaker therapy implants. Category III CPT codes reflect emerging technologies. Category III CPT Code Category III CPT Code Description 0387T Transcatheter insertion or replacement of permanent leadless pacemaker, ventricular 0388T Transcatheter removal of permanent leadless pacemaker, ventricular 0389T Programming device evaluation (in person) with iterative adjustment of the implantable device to test the function of the device and select optimal permanent programmed values with analysis, review and report, leadless pacemaker system 0390T Peri-procedural device evaluation (in person) and programming of device system parameters before or after a surgery, procedure or test with analysis, review and report, leadless pacemaker system 0391T Interrogation device evaluation (in-person)

6 With analysis review and report, includes connection, recording and disconnection per patient encounter, leadless pacemaker system Micra is a single chamber pacemaker, as such, we believe it falls under the CMS National coverage Determination (NCD). Cardiac Pacemaker Evaluation Services guidelines. You should check with your Medicare Administrative Contractor (MAC). for further guidance. Physician The Category III CPT codes reflect emerging technologies, and there are no assigned Relative Value Units (RVUs) for the calculation of physician PAYMENT . Medicare assigned XXX (the global concept does not apply) to all five codes; PAYMENT is at the discretion of the applicable Medicare Administrative Contractor (MAC). Because there is no assigned Medicare PAYMENT for Category III codes, physicians submitting a claim for the Micra implant are advised to reference an existing service or procedure that is comparable to the Micra procedure in costs and resources.

10 Page 3 of 6 | AUGUST 2017 . Potential reference procedures* may include: CPT Description 33207 Insertion of new or replacement of permanent pacemaker with transvenous electrode(s), ventricular 33216 Insertion of a single transvenous electrode, permanent pacemaker or cardioverter-defibrillator 93580 Percutaneous transcatheter closure of congenital interatrial communication ( , Fontan fenestration, atrial septal defect) with implant 93581 Percutaneous transcatheter closure of a congenital ventricular septal defect with implant * One or more of these comparisons might be provided in claims submission to help determine appropriate reimbursement for this implant procedure. Each provider must determine the most appropriate reference code. These are examples only, not an exhaustive or definitive list.
